UPNEDA Calls for Expressions of Interest for 1.3 GW Solar Projects

Representational image. Credit: Canva

The Uttar Pradesh New and Renewable Energy Development Agency (UPNEDA) has issued an Expression of Interest (EOI) inviting prospective bidders to establish 1.3 GW solar power projects in the Jhansi district. The projects are proposed to be developed in Tehsils Garautha and Mauranipur under a Build-Own-Operate model.

Interested parties can submit their e-bids through the official e-tendering platform. The deadline for submission of bids is January 31, 2025, by 6:00 PM, with technical bid openings scheduled for February 1, 2025, at 12:00 PM.

The proposed 1.3 GW solar power project in Jhansi, Uttar Pradesh, will utilize 5,508 acres of land, including 957 acres of leased government land and 4,551 acres of private land across 10 villages. This innovative project aims to enhance renewable energy capacity, utilize wastelands, and promote green power under UPNEDA’s Solar Energy Policy 2022.

There are no charges for the EOI document, processing fee, or Earnest Money Deposit for this project.

This initiative is part of UPNEDA’s broader strategy to harness renewable energy potential and enhance sustainable power infrastructure across Uttar Pradesh. The agency has emphasized its right to cancel the EOI process at its discretion without assigning reasons.
